import ContractByteArrayEncoder from './ContractByteArrayEncoder.js' import BytecodeTypeResolver from './BytecodeTypeResolver.js' import ApiEncoder from './ApiEncoder.js' import EventEncoder from './EventEncoder.js' import {FateTypeCalldata, FateTypeString} from './FateTypes.js' import EncoderError from './Errors/EncoderError.js' class BytecodeContractCallEncoder { /** * Creates contract encoder using bytecode as type info provider * * @example * const bytecode = require('./Test.aeb') * const encoder = new BytecodeContractCallEncoder(bytecode) * * @param {string} bytecode - Contract bytecode using cannonical format. */ constructor(bytecode) { /** @type {ContractByteArrayEncoder} */ this._byteArrayEncoder = new ContractByteArrayEncoder() /** @type {BytecodeTypeResolver} */ this._typeResolver = new BytecodeTypeResolver(bytecode) /** @type {ApiEncoder} */ this._apiEncoder = new ApiEncoder() /** @type {EventEncoder} */ this._eventEncoder = new EventEncoder() } /** * Creates contract call data * * @example * const encoded = encoder.encodeCall('test_string', ["whoolymoly"]) * console.log(`Encoded data: ${encoded}`) * // Outputs: * // Encoded data: cb_KxHwzCuVGyl3aG9vbHltb2x5zwMSnw== * * @param {string} funName - The function name as defined in the bytecode. * @param {Array} args - An array of call arguments as Javascript data structures. See README.md * @returns {string} Encoded calldata */ encodeCall(funName, args) { const {types, required} = this._typeResolver.getCallTypes(funName) if (args.length > types.length || args.length < required) { throw new EncoderError( 'Non matching number of arguments. ' + `${funName} expects between ${required} and ${types.length} number of arguments but got ${args.length}` ) } return this._byteArrayEncoder.encode(FateTypeCalldata(funName, types), args) } /** * Decodes contract calldata * * @example * const data = encoder.decodeCall('cb_KxHwzCuVGyl3aG9vbHltb2x5zwMSnw==') * console.log('Decoded data:', data) * // Outputs: * // Decoded data: { * // functionId: 'aee52c3c', * // functionName: 'test_template_maze', * // args: [ 'whoolymoly' ] * // } * * @param {string} data - Encoded calldata in canonical format. * @returns {object} Decoded calldata */ decodeCall(data) { const {functionId, args} = this._byteArrayEncoder.decodeWithType(data, FateTypeCalldata()) const functionName = this._typeResolver.getFunctionName(functionId) return { functionId, functionName, args } } /** * Decodes successful (resultType = ok) contract call return data * * @example * const decoded = encoder.decode('test_string', 'cb_KXdob29seW1vbHlGazSE') * console.log(`Decoded data: ${decoded}`) * // Outputs: * // Decoded data: whoolymoly * * @param {string} funName - The function name as defined in the bytecode. * @param {string} data - The call return value in a canonical format. * @param {'ok'|'revert'|'error'} resultType - The call result type. * @returns {boolean|string|BigInt|Array|Map|Object} * Decoded value as Javascript data structures. See README.md */ decodeResult(funName, data, resultType = 'ok') { if (resultType === 'ok') { const type = this._typeResolver.getReturnType(funName) return this._byteArrayEncoder.decodeWithType(data, type) } if (resultType === 'error') { const decoder = new TextDecoder() const bytes = this._apiEncoder.decodeWithType(data, 'contract_bytearray') return decoder.decode(bytes) } if (resultType === 'revert') { return this._byteArrayEncoder.decodeWithType(data, FateTypeString()) } throw new EncoderError(`Unknown call resutls type: "${resultType}"`) } } export default BytecodeContractCallEncoder
